算法与数据结构
幻影宇寰
幻变的生命,留下的永远是最真诚的记忆!
展开
-
数据结构学习整理
一、相关概念数据结构是相互之间存在一种或多种特定关系的数据的集合。1、抽象层-逻辑结构数据元素之间的逻辑关系称为数据的逻辑结构。数据的逻辑结构可以看作是从具体问题抽象出来的数学模型,它与数据的存储无关。1.1、集合结构(集)结构中的数据元素除了同属于一个集合外没有其他关系。1.2、线性结构(表)结构中的数据元素具有一对一的前后关系。1.3、树型结构(树)结构中的数据元素具有一对多的父子关系。原创 2016-06-06 23:25:00 · 4860 阅读 · 0 评论 -
算法基础:排序与查找
1、直接插入排序1.1、基本思想:在要排序的一组数中,假设前面(n-1) [n>=2] 个数已经是排好顺序的,现在要把第n个数插到前面的有序数中,使得这n个数也是排好顺序的;如此反复循环,直到全部排好顺序。原创 2016-06-23 22:36:33 · 6510 阅读 · 1 评论